The impression I get from his interviews is that he kind of makes stuff up as he goes along. Like, he writes the stage music for stage 1, programs a level for stage one, and then comes up with the boss after he's already got the stage done, rinse and repeat 7 times (including Extra). I mean, hopefully he has some vague idea of where he's going, but the precise details like whether or not Byakuren is an old man or a space invader aren't settled until he actually gets there. So I doubt there's concept art of Old Man Myouren or anything like that. It was just an idea bubbling in the back of his mind before he got around to the part where he would use it.

A while ago the guys who usually do translation patches came in here and said they don't feel like translating and patching Hopeless Masquerade because they not only really dislike the game, TasoFro's code is also so labyrinthine and shoddy they don't wanna expend the effort for a game they don't actually like. So short of someone else rising up to the challenge you can wait a long time for a translation to come out. Just look at the translations on the touhou wiki and that touhou endings wiki if you need to know what the characters are saying. As for EoSD's extra stage being easier than others, it's really not. The stage potion itself might be easier than some of the others, but Flandre alone makes it the hardest extra stage in my experience, coupled with the fact that EoSD Extra gives you the least resources of all extra stages with only two additional extra lives and nothing else. The thing about GFW Extra is that the game heavily relies on its freezing gimmick, so until you got a good route planned to make optimal use of freezing, it's gonna be significantly harder than other stages, but once you do it becomes a whole lot more manageable.
